How this automation works
Whenever a new GitHub issue is assigned to you, this applet creates a detailed link note in your chosen Evernote notebook. It helps you quickly review and organize your assigned work with issue details and labels. Perfect for keeping track of all your development tasks in one place.

About Evernote
Evernote is a cross-platform, freemium app designed for note taking, organizing, and archiving. Turn on Applets to sync and save the information you care about to your notebooks — automatically and quickly.

About GitHub
GitHub is the best place to share code with friends, co-workers, classmates, and complete strangers. Turn on Applets to automatically track issues, pull requests, repositories, and to quickly create issues.
